How to Adjust a Knee Scooter for a Perfect Fit
Knee scooters offer a convenient and comfortable alternative to crutches, but only if adjusted properly. A poorly adjusted knee scooter can lead to discomfort, pain, and even injury. This guide will walk you through the essential adjustments to ensure your knee scooter is perfectly fitted for your needs. Proper adjustment is key for optimal comfort, safety, and efficient mobility.
Understanding Your Knee Scooter's Adjustable Parts
Before we dive into the adjustments, it's crucial to understand which parts are adjustable on your specific knee scooter model. Most knee scooters have adjustable features including:
- Handlebar Height: This is arguably the most important adjustment. The handlebars should be at a height that allows you to stand comfortably upright with a slight bend in your elbows.
- Handlebar Angle: Some models allow you to adjust the angle of the handlebars to suit your posture and preferences. This fine-tunes your comfort and reduces strain.
- Knee Pad Position: The knee pad should be positioned to provide comfortable support without pressure points. The adjustment might be a simple sliding mechanism or a more complex system.
- Brake Adjustment: Ensure your brakes are functioning properly and engaging easily. This is crucial for safety.
Step-by-Step Guide to Adjusting Your Knee Scooter
Let's go through the adjustment process step-by-step:
1. Adjusting the Handlebar Height
This is the most critical adjustment. Follow these steps:
- Find a comfortable standing position: Stand upright near your knee scooter.
- Adjust the handlebars: Most scooters have a simple locking mechanism. Loosen this mechanism and raise or lower the handlebars until your elbows are slightly bent when you're holding them comfortably. Your wrists should be straight and relaxed.
- Lock the handlebars: Securely tighten the locking mechanism to maintain the chosen height.
- Test the height: Take a few steps to ensure the height feels comfortable and allows for easy movement.
2. Adjusting the Handlebar Angle (if applicable)
If your scooter has adjustable handlebar angles, you can fine-tune your posture and comfort:
- Experiment with different angles: Slightly tilt the handlebars forward or backward to find a position that feels most natural and reduces strain on your wrists and shoulders.
- Lock the angle: Securely tighten the locking mechanism after you’ve found the optimal angle.
- Test your posture: Again, take a few steps to evaluate your comfort level and overall posture.
3. Adjusting the Knee Pad Position
The knee pad's position significantly impacts comfort and circulation:
- Adjust the knee pad: This is usually a sliding mechanism. Adjust the position to ensure the knee pad is firmly positioned under your knee, providing support without causing pressure points or discomfort.
- Test for comfort: Take a test drive, making sure the knee pad is comfortable and not hindering circulation.
4. Checking and Adjusting the Brakes
Ensure your brakes are always functioning properly:
- Test the brakes: Test the brakes to ensure they engage easily and effectively.
- Adjust the brakes (if necessary): Most models offer a way to adjust brake sensitivity. Consult your knee scooter’s manual for instructions.
Maintaining Your Knee Scooter
Regular maintenance ensures your knee scooter remains comfortable and safe. This includes:
- Cleaning the knee pad and handlebars: Regularly clean these areas to maintain hygiene and comfort.
- Inspecting the wheels and brakes: Check for wear and tear, and replace any worn-out components as needed.
- Lubricating moving parts: Occasionally lubricate moving parts to keep everything running smoothly.
By following these steps, you can ensure your knee scooter is properly adjusted for a comfortable, safe, and efficient mobility solution. Remember to always refer to your scooter's user manual for specific instructions and safety guidelines.
